The U.S. government recently announced a $2 billion investment initiative focused on advancing quantum computing capabilities. The funding is earmarked for research programs, public-private partnerships, and infrastructure development across federal labs, universities, and private companies. The announcement comes as quantum computing moves from theoretical exploration toward practical applications in areas such as cryptography, drug discovery, and optimization. The source article notes that while the government’s commitment is substantial, some of the best-known quantum computing firms have already experienced notable price appreciation, prompting discussion about whether the public sector may have missed the optimal entry point for direct equity investment. The initiative is part of a broader national strategy to maintain technological leadership, with similar efforts underway in other countries. Key takeaways from the announcement include the strategic importance the government places on quantum computing as a critical technology for national security and economic competitiveness. The $2 billion infusion could potentially accelerate the timeline for achieving fault-tolerant quantum systems and expand the pool of companies and researchers able to work on advanced algorithms and hardware. Funding may also stimulate demand for talent and infrastructure, benefiting the entire quantum ecosystem. However, the sector remains at an early stage; many applications are still years from commercial viability. The article suggests that while government backing provides a positive tailwind, it does not directly translate into short-term returns for individual companies. Market participants are now evaluating which firms might best leverage the grants and contracts that will stem from the initiative. From an investment perspective, the government’s $2 billion commitment adds a layer of support that could reduce some of the technology risk associated with quantum computing. Still, potential investors should consider the inherent uncertainties of a nascent industry—technical hurdles, high capital requirements, and an unclear path to widespread adoption. The funding does not eliminate the competitive risks or guarantee that any single company will emerge as a leader. Market expectations may need to be tempered with patience, as meaningful revenue from quantum computing could still be several years away. Broader sector catalysts, such as new experimental milestones or partnerships, may continue to influence sentiment. Investors are advised to weigh the long-term potential against the current lack of profitability and the possibility of dilution from follow-on financing.
